01 · Challenge
A bold outdoor retreat beside a terraced house in Breda
The owners of a semi-detached house in Breda-Noord wanted a covered outdoor space that matches the lifestyle of the neighbourhood: warm, robust and sturdy. The property is located in an expansion district with a uniform block pattern and the aesthetic regulations here are relatively flexible for outbuildings and canopies at the rear. Nonetheless, the custom work in the timber species and connection details required careful elaboration in the drawings.
02 · Our approach
Hardwood with a curved roof plane
We designed a veranda in finger-jointed azobe hardwood, with a gently undulating roof plane in bituminous roofing that connects to the existing eaves of the house. The posts are founded on driven ground anchors so that no concrete blocks are visible in the garden. The rear of the veranda has been left open, allowing the space to also serve as a passage point to the rear garden. Side panels can be added later if the owners wish for more enclosure.
03 · Result
Immediate start, solid end result
The 16 m² veranda was installed in three days by a local Breda contractor. The result is a bold, dark-coloured canopy that visually extends the garden and makes outdoor living possible all year round. The owners are particularly pleased with the choice of hardwood, which improves with age. Tekenpunt provided all the execution details needed for a flawless installation.
